HomeTime-off request processing and approval flowsStaff Management & HRTime-off request processing and approval flows

Time-off request processing and approval flows

Purpose

 1.1. Automate the submission, review, approval, and notification of time-off requests for direct care staff and administrators in adult foster care environments.
 1.2. Ensure compliance with staffing regulations and accurate leave balances.
 1.3. Minimize manual oversight, prevent double-booking, and maintain real-time transparency for HR, supervisors, and payroll.
 1.4. Integrate with schedules, alerts, HRIS, and payroll systems to synchronize time-off data across all platforms.

Trigger Conditions

 2.1. Staff member submits a leave request (via form, email, HR portal, or mobile app).
 2.2. Scheduled review dates for pending or expiring time-off requests.
 2.3. Approval or rejection response by supervisor/manager.
 2.4. Threshold breach (e.g., too many staff off on same day) detected by scheduling platform.

Platform Variants (20 software/services)

 3.1. Workday
  • Feature/Setting: 'Create Time Off Request' API; configure callback on 'Approve/Reject'.
 3.2. BambooHR
  • Feature/Setting: 'Time Off Requests API'; webhooks for approval or update.
 3.3. ADP Workforce Now
  • Feature/Setting: 'Time Off Management API'; scheduled polling for new requests.
 3.4. UKG Ready (Kronos)
  • Feature/Setting: 'Leave of Absence Request' API; notification configuration for supervisor action.
 3.5. SAP SuccessFactors
  • Feature/Setting: 'Absence Management API'; workflow triggers on leave approval.
 3.6. Zenefits
  • Feature/Setting: 'Time Off Request' webhook; outbound notification when status changes.
 3.7. Google Workspace
  • Feature/Setting: Google Forms for collection, Apps Script for data transfer; Gmail API for notifications.
 3.8. Microsoft Outlook & Exchange
  • Feature/Setting: Outlook Forms; Office 365 Graph API to approve, respond, and update calendar invites.
 3.9. Slack
  • Feature/Setting: Workflow Builder; automated message and interactive approval in HR channel.
 3.10. Asana
  • Feature/Setting: Forms for request intake; API for task creation and status update.
 3.11. Trello
  • Feature/Setting: Automation Rules for card movement on 'HR Board'; webhook triggers on approval.
 3.12. Jira Service Management
  • Feature/Setting: Custom workflow for leave requests; webhook/API to send event updates.
 3.13. monday.com
  • Feature/Setting: Forms for frontend intake; automation recipes for notifications and approval flow.
 3.14. Zoho People
  • Feature/Setting: Leave API; workflow automation for multi-level approval and alert.
 3.15. Paychex Flex
  • Feature/Setting: Time-off request API; event hooks for next-step notifications.
 3.16. Paycor
  • Feature/Setting: Employee Self-Service (ESS) portal integration; API for leave request and approval status.
 3.17. ServiceNow HR Service Delivery
  • Feature/Setting: Case and Knowledge Management; flow designer for custom approval steps.
 3.18. Okta (for SSO and Directory-triggered events)
  • Feature/Setting: OKTA Workflows; triggers on new employee or staff status changes.
 3.19. DocuSign
  • Feature/Setting: Document Routing API; template for request/approval with signature tracking.
 3.20. Twilio SMS
  • Feature/Setting: SMS receive for request intake; programmable SMS API for approval/rejection response.
 3.21. HubSpot (for small teams)
  • Feature/Setting: Web form for requests; automated workflow for notification/record update.
 3.22. Salesforce Service Cloud
  • Feature/Setting: Custom Objects for time-off; Process Builder or Flow to manage approvals and alerts.

Benefits

 4.1. Reduces manual, error-prone processes for leave management.
 4.2. Enables timely, auditable, and consistent approval/rejection workflows.
 4.3. Improves staff planning, schedule reliability, and compliance.
 4.4. Ensures accurate, real-time data for HR, payroll, and management oversight.
 4.5. Standardizes communication to minimize misunderstandings or missed approvals.

Leave a Reply

Your email address will not be published. Required fields are marked *